Consider a problem involving tow rubber balls. The upper ballhas half the mass of the lower ball. Both are dropped from the sameheight and so they arrive at thetable traveling downward at a givenspeed v0. Assume the lower ball bounces perfectly elastically offthe table, and is now moving upward at v0, then bouncesperfectlyelastically off the upper ball (which at that moment stillmoving downward at v0.) Find the final speed upward of the upperball immediately after the collisions. (Hint will begreater thenv0).
